TROPOS are GO!

FM reception was getting a little crazy this morning - Cape Cod radio is coming in unusually loud and clear north of Boston. WATD was getting bumped by a station playing Classical music at 95.9. Interference from WRIU at 90.3.

Haven't picked up NYC, Philly, Baltimore, DC, Richmond, GA, or Florida stations yet.. but on a hot day like today - it's something to listen for: it's Tropo time !
 
94.3 (NPR on the Cape) coming in on North Shore. So was WXTK 95.1, last night...

With tropo in full swing, the 95.9 Signpost heard was WCRI on Block Island. They duke it out with WATD from time to time.
